TRENTON, NJ - Seven state troopers who were suspended after a college student claimed she was raped at one of their homes will not be charged with a crime, a prosecutor said yesterday.
Stephanie Kurowsky, a spokeswoman for the Middlesex County prosecutor, said that the case has been closed, but would not comment further.
"Our clients are elated that they have been completely exonerated. They look forward to resuming their careers and their lives," lawyers for the troopers said in a joint statement.
In December, the 24-year-old College of New Jersey student told authorities she had been raped by a group of troopers she met at a Trenton nightclub.
